Output 6ef129d98aca996f073debdc1b87f4795a8337cc312eba0da0a7d7e5691f8766:56

value
62170817
script pubkey
OP_0 OP_PUSHBYTES_20 76a402e18ef76f3278e9b27afbd2226b8c3cf9a9
address
bc1qw6jq9cvw7ahny78fkfa0h53zdwxre7dfduqqjg
transaction
6ef129d98aca996f073debdc1b87f4795a8337cc312eba0da0a7d7e5691f8766
spent
true